Weekly Update: 7th September 2019

Div 1 Week 27 – Wetherill Park – 7 September

The division bowled 7 pins over average at Wetherill Park with 33 200 games and 10 600 series. The high game went to reserve Ryan Chi 255, George Antaky 249, Garry Graham 247, reserve Ecky Liem 243, Phil Meura nt 237, Allan Taylor 236, Chris Greaves 232, new reserve Kyle Jarvis 231, reserve Howard Goss 228 and Phil again 225. The series went to Ryan 691, George 661, Phil 653, Rob Mitreski 633, Garry 632, Brett Foster 627, Chris 612, David Chi 611, Wolf Miller 606 and Allan Taylor 603, with a special mention for Adam Burrows with a 599. The ladies high game went to Samantha Batten 208, Carol Stenstra 199, Melinda Murphy 198, Amy Martin 195, reserve Lisa Love 192, Samantha again 189, Carol again 183, Jodie Terry 181, reserve Marilyn Wentworth-Perry 180 and Jodie again 175. The series went to Carol 529, Samantha 524, Melinda and Jodie 523, Amy 506, Lisa 483, Julie Strickland 480, Rebeccanne Farr and Janice Edwards 459 and Alison Bird 453.

Leaders Bowlarama Blackjacks won 12½ - 6½ but had their lead cut to 15 as Tenpin City Dark Knights won 14-5. 3rd place Bowlarama Gorillas lost 10-9 to Gosford Grenades while 4th place Wetherill Park Guns closed within 12 points of 3rd place winning 12-7. Strathfield 5 of a Kind won 11-8 and Rooty Hill Rogues scored 16 on the bye. The high game went to Blackjacks 970, 5 of a Kind 969 and Gorillas 966. The series went to Dark Knight 2839, Gorillas 2779 and Grenades 2773.

Div 2 Week 28 – Mittagong Highlanders – 7 September.

The division bowled 7½ pins under average at Mittagong with 8 200 games and 1 600 series. The high game went to Madison McCooey 235 and 206, Kathy Compton 203 and 189, Maria Wrublewski also 189, Angela Francis 186, Elaine Llewelyn 185, Ros Dowton 183, Angela again 182 and Tracy Hodgson 178. The series also went to Madison 603, followed by Kathy 562, Angela 537, Maria 503, Marianne Keith 486, Tracy 485, Ros Dowton 475, Ros Kirkland 471, Kay Ginger 457 and Sandra Burchall 453. For the men, the high game went to Ray Dillon 222, Bob Cohen 218, Kyle Keith-Wheatley 209, John Barrett 204, Richard Malcolm 201, Tony Sutton and Nathan Bracey 198, Mark Foster 195 and Michael Hey nsdyk and Kevin Fox 194. The series went to Bob 574, John 568, Michael 563, Ray 554, Kevin 553, Nathan 527, Richard 523, Phil Isaac 518 and Ian Compton 515.

Leaders Rooty Hill Rhinos won 15-4, stretching their lead to 44½ points as 2nd place Lidcombe Lynx lost 5½ - 13½ to 4th place Rooty Hill Strikers with Lynx dropping to 3rd and Strikers moving into 2nd place. 3rd place Bowlarama Alleycatz lost 13-6 to Western Force and dropped to 4th spot while 5th place Strathfield Vikings also lost 11-8 to Strathfield Sharks and dropped to 6th spot. Campbelltown City Sixers won 17-2 to move up from 6th spot to 5th with positions 2 to 7 separated by only 14 points. Wetherill Park Rebels won 15-4, Rooty Hill Explosion won 11-8 and Wetherill Park Cobras won 12-7. The high game went to Sixers 871, Force 859 and Rhinos 855. The series also went to Sixers 2545, Force 2447 and Rhinos 2369.
